Solution for -n^2+7n=0 equation:


Simplifying
-1n2 + 7n = 0

Reorder the terms:
7n + -1n2 = 0

Solving
7n + -1n2 = 0

Solving for variable 'n'.

Factor out the Greatest Common Factor (GCF), 'n'.
n(7 + -1n) = 0

Subproblem 1

Set the factor 'n'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ying n = 0 Solving n = 0 Move all terms containing n to the left, all other terms to the right. Simplifying n = 0

Subproblem 2

Set the factor '(7 + -1n)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 7 + -1n = 0 Solving 7 + -1n = 0 Move all terms containing n to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-7' to each side of the equation. 7 + -7 + -1n = 0 + -7 Combine like terms: 7 + -7 = 0 0 + -1n = 0 + -7 -1n = 0 + -7 Combine like terms: 0 + -7 = -7 -1n = -7 Divide each side by '-1'. n = 7 Simplifying n = 7

Solution

n = {0, 7}
